日志
日志(log)是一种记录计算机系统或应用程序生成的文本或电子数据的文件。它可以记录用户的操作、系统的事件、错误信息等,用于审计、故障排查和数据分析等目的。日志通常包括时间戳、事件描述、级别、设备信息等内容。
### 日志的主要作用
1. **审计和监控**:通过查看日志文件,管理员可以了解系统的使用情况,包括哪个用户在进行哪些操作,系统是否遭受了攻击等。这对于确保系统的安全性和可靠性至关重要。
2. **故障排查**:当系统出现故障时,日志文件可以提供关于问题的详细信息。例如,错误日志可以指示出问题的原因,如代码中的bug、硬件故障等。通过分析日志,技术人员可以更快地定位问题并采取相应的解决措施。
3. **数据分析**:对于大规模的数据处理系统,日志文件可能包含宝贵的信息。通过对日志进行分析,可以了解用户的行为模式、系统的使用趋势等,从而为系统的优化和改进提供依据。
### 日志的级别
日志的级别通常分为几个层次,包括:
* **DEBUG**:表示最低级别的日志,记录非常详细的信息,适用于开发过程中的调试和排错。
* **INFO**:表示一般的日志信息,记录系统的一般状态和事件。
* **WARNING**:表示警告级别的日志,指出可能的问题或潜在的风险。
* **ERROR**:表示错误级别的日志,指出严重的错误,可能需要立即采取措施。
* **CRITICAL**:表示最高级别的日志,指出系统完全失效或面临严重的安全威胁。
### 日志的管理和维护
日志的管理和维护是确保系统正常运行的重要环节。以下是一些建议:
1. **定期清理**:删除旧的、不再需要的日志文件,以节省存储空间。
2. **归档和备份**:将重要的日志文件归档到其他存储介质上,以便在需要时进行查阅。
3. **安全性管理**:确保日志文件的安全性,防止未经授权的访问和篡改。
4. **分析工具**:使用专门的日志分析工具来提取有价值的信息,帮助理解系统的运行状况。
总之,日志是记录和监控系统的重要工具,通过合理地管理和维护,可以确保系统的安全和稳定运行,并为问题的排查和解决提供有力的支持。